Mr. Palomar by Italo Calvino

Bound in 2015

Secker & Warburg 1985, First Edition
214 x 139 x 10 mm

Full leather binding in orange goatskin with tooling in various colours. Ultra flatback.
Endpapers printed using cyanotype process. Hand sewn silk headbands.

In 27 short chapters, Mr. Palomar makes philosophical observations about the world around him. Calvino describes a man on a quest to quantify complex phenomena in a search for fundamental truths on the nature of being. There is a thematic index at the end of the book and all the letters and punctuation marks from the titles of sections, subsections and chapters (i.e. 1. Mr. Palomar's Vacation / 1.3.3. The Contemplation of the Stars) have been jumbled to create the cover of the book typographically.
